What is an assistant operator?

Assistant Operators are entry-level professionals who support the operation of machinery or equipment in industries such as manufacturing, energy, or logistics. They work under the supervision of senior operators to help monitor processes, perform basic maintenance, and ensure safety protocols are followed. Their responsibilities may include setting up machines, loading materials, inspecting products, and reporting any issues to supervisors. Assistant Operators play a key role in maintaining efficient production and minimizing downtime. This position is often a stepping stone to more advanced operator roles.

What are some common challenges assistant operators face during shift changes, and how can they be managed effectively?

Assistant Operators often encounter challenges during shift changes, such as incomplete handovers or miscommunication about ongoing tasks. To manage these effectively, it’s important to follow standardized handover procedures, maintain accurate and up-to-date logs, and communicate proactively with both outgoing and incoming team members. Building strong teamwork and attention to detail helps ensure a smooth transition and minimizes operational disruptions.

Job description

Looking for more than just a job? Start a career with long-term growth, real advancement opportunities, and hourly pay of $29.65.

Ag Processing Inc (AGP) is seeking motivated individuals who want to build a future in a stable, essential industry. No experience is required - we provide the training. What matters most is reliability, initiative, and a willingness to learn.

Essential Responsibilities

  • Operate, monitor, and adjust production equipment to maintain efficient plant operations.

  • Monitor process controls, gauges, and equipment performance to ensure safe and effective operation.

  • Collect product samples according to standard operating procedures and perform or coordinate quality testing.

  • Make process adjustments based on quality results and operating conditions.

  • Maintain accurate production records, equipment logs, and shift documentation.

  • Perform routine inspections, housekeeping, and preventive maintenance on equipment.

  • Assist with minor equipment repairs and identify maintenance needs.

  • Safely operate equipment such as forklifts, pallet jacks, or similar equipment, as required.

  • Follow all company safety policies, food safety requirements (if applicable), and environmental regulations.

  • Work collaboratively with team members and communicate production issues to supervisors.

  • Perform other duties as assigned.

What We're Looking For

We're looking for individuals who:

  • Take initiative and work efficiently

  • Are dependable and motivated to perform at a high level

  • Have a strong attention to detail

  • Work well as part of a team

  • Are willing to learn new skills and responsibilities

  • Can understand and follow rules, procedures, and safety policies

  • Have basic reading, math, and communication skills

Minimum Requirements

  • At least 18 years old

  • Valid driver's license

  • Ability to safely operate material handling equipment (training provided)

  • Ability to:

    • Carry 50 pounds

    • Lift up to 65 pounds

    • Push/pull up to 120 pounds

Work Environment

This is a hands-on industrial position. Candidates should be comfortable:

  • Working outdoors in all weather conditions

  • Working around grain dust and industrial equipment

  • Climbing ladders and stairs up to 120 feet high

  • Working rotating 12-hour shifts, including days, nights, weekends, and holidays

Typical schedule:

  • Rotating swing shifts (8a-8p / 8p-8a)

  • Multiple consecutive workdays followed by multiple days off

Career Growth Opportunities

Many of our Supervisors started in an operator position like this one. Employees who demonstrate initiative, reliability, and leadership can advance into:

  • Specialized equipment operations

  • Maintenance support roles

  • Leadership and supervisory positions

Who We Are

Ag Processing Inc (AGP) is a cooperative founded in 1983 that processes, sells and transports soybeans, grains, and related products. Our company has become one of the largest soybean processing cooperatives in the world and our plants process soybeans that can be used in a variety of products such as animal feed, vegetable oil, and fuels.
